Temperature Sensors
A temperature sensor is a device used to measure the temperature of an environment, object or system. Temperature sensors are used in a variety of applications, ranging from monitoring the temperature of a refrigerator to controlling the emissions of a car engine. Temperature sensors come in many different types, but the most common types are thermistors, thermocouples, RTDs and thermometers. Each type of temperature sensor has its own unique advantages and disadvantages. In general, thermistors are the most common type used due to their high accuracy and low cost. RTDs and thermocouples are typically used for higher temperature accuracy and glass thermometers are traditionally used for low cost, low accuracy applications.
